/*
* The transport code maintains an estimate on the maximum number of out-
* standing RPC requests, using a smoothed version of the congestion
* avoidance implemented in 44BSD. This is basically the Van Jacobson
* slow start algorithm: If a retransmit occurs, the congestion window is
* halved; otherwise, it is incremented by 1/cwnd when
*
* - a reply is received and
* - a full number of requests are outstanding and
* - the congestion window hasn't been updated recently.
*
* Upper procedures may check whether a request would block waiting for
* a free RPC slot by using the RPC_CONGESTED() macro.
*
* Note: on machines with low memory we should probably use a smaller
* MAXREQS value: At 32 outstanding reqs with 8 megs of RAM, fragment
* reassembly will frequently run out of memory.
* Come Linux 2.3, we'll handle fragments directly.
*/
#define RPC_MAXCONG 16
#define RPC_MAXREQS (RPC_MAXCONG + 1)
#define RPC_CWNDSCALE 256
#define RPC_MAXCWND (RPC_MAXCONG * RPC_CWNDSCALE)
#define RPC_INITCWND RPC_CWNDSCALE
#define RPCXPRT_CONGESTED(xprt) \
((xprt)->cong >= ((xprt)->nocong? RPC_MAXCWND : (xprt)->cwnd))
